- Abstract: Objective??To?investigate?the?effect?of?local?administration?of?recombinant?adenovirus?of?human?adiponectin?(hAPN)?Ad-hAPN-EGFP?on?tibial?defect?repair?of?SD?rats. Methods??Tibial?defect?(2?mm)?models?of?36?SD?rats?(72?sides)?were?randomly?divided?into?three?groups?(A,?B,?and?C;?n=24).?The?three?groups?were?injected?with?Ad-hAPN-EGFP,?Ad-EGFP,?and?normal?saline,?respectively,?during?operation?and?the?day?after?operation.?A?week?after?the?operation,?the?expres-sion?of?hAPN?and?osteogenesis-related?factors?were?detected?by?real-time?polymerase?chain?reaction.?Three?weeks?after?operation,?the?tibias?were?examined?by?micro-computed?tomography,?hematoxylin-eosin?staining,?and?Masson?staining?to?evaluate?the?restoration?of?bone?defects.?Results??1)?The?hAPN?expression?was?detected?in?group?A?but?not?in?groups?B?and?C.?Osteogenesis-related?factors?expression?of?group?A?was?significantly?higher?than?that?of?the?other?groups?(P<0.05).?2)?Osteogenesis?(including?bone?mineral?density,?relative?bone?volume,?trabecular?number?and?trabecular?thickness)?in?group?A?were?more?evident?than?those?in?groups?B?and?C?(P<0.05).?No?significant?differences?were?found?between?groups?B?and?C?(P>0.05).?Conclusion??Local?administration?of?recombinant?adenovirus?Ad-hAPN-EGFP?may?be?an?effective?strategy?to?improve?the?restoration?of?bone?defects?in vivo.
